How Search Engines Work

Before you use a search engine, it’s good to have brief understanding of how one works.

Search engines look at all of the available web pages that exist, which is similar to a librarian finding all the books in a library.

The search engines would then look at the page content of each page, which would be alike to a librarian reading all the books in a library.

Then the search engine can use that information to recommend the right page for you, which is similar to having the librarian find you the right book.
